Interactive terrain-aware route planning with DEM analysis. Click-to-place waypoints on a map and find optimal paths using terrain analysis.
- Interactive Map: Click to place waypoints on a Leaflet terrain map
- Pathfinding: Find optimal paths using a Rust WASM module with A* algorithm
- Real-time Visualization: Watch the pathfinding algorithm explore the terrain
- Aspect Analysis: Visualize terrain aspects with a raster overlay; exclude certain aspects from pathfinding
- Gradient Control: Set maximum gradient constraints for the pathfinding algorithm (limits ascent only — skis descend terrain far steeper than they can climb, so descents and cross-slope traverses are governed by the aspect exclusion and runout rules instead)
- Elevation Profile: View the elevation profile of your planned route
- Gradient Distribution: Analyze the gradient distribution with a CDF chart
- Aspect Distribution: See the aspect distribution of your route
- GPX Export: Download your planned route as a GPX file

- DEM tiles are fetched directly from AWS S3-hosted Terrain Tiles (Terrarium format)
- Tiles are decoded, stitched, and cached in IndexedDB for offline/repeat use
- WASM module runs in a Web Worker for non-blocking UI
- Exploration updates stream back to main thread for real-time visualization
The static export (output: 'export') enables hosting on any static file server (Netlify, GitHub Pages, S3, etc.).
